LifeVantage Ranks #6 on Utah Business Magazine Fast 50 – EIN News (press release)

The firm achieves highest rating of all Utah-based Direct Selling corporations

SALT LAKE CITY, Aug. 22, 2016 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— For the third time prior to now 5 years, LifeVantage has been ranked within the Top 10 on Utah Business journal’s annual Fast 50. The firm ranks #6 on the 2016 listing that was simply launched by Utah Business.

/EIN News/ — The Utah Business Fast 50 acknowledges 50 of the quickest rising corporations within the state, celebrating them for his or her entrepreneurial spirit, progressive enterprise techniques, and skyrocketing income progress. The corporations are chosen and ranked based mostly on monetary knowledge submitted to an unbiased accountant for evaluation.

About LifeVantage Corporation

LifeVantage Corporation (Nasdaq:LFVN), is a science based mostly community advertising firm devoted to visionary science that appears to rework well being, wellness and anti-getting older internally and externally on the mobile degree. The firm is the maker of the Protandim® line of scientifically validated dietary complement, the TrueScience® Anti-Aging Skin Care Regimen, Canine Health®, the AXIO® power product line and the PhysIQ™ sensible weight administration system. LifeVantage was based in 2003 and is headquartered in Salt Lake City, Utah.
